DBP stages in consuming water is usually minimized through the use of disinfectants such as ozone, chloramines, or chlorine dioxide. Like chlorine, their oxidative Attributes are enough to break some pretreatment unit functions and has to be taken out early from the pretreatment system. The complete elimination of A few of these disinfectants might be problematic. For instance, chloramines might degrade over the disinfection method or through pretreatment removal, therefore releasing ammonia, which subsequently can carry in excess of for the completed water. Pretreatment unit functions has to be designed and operated to sufficiently take away the disinfectant, ingesting water DBPs, and objectionable disinfectant degradants. A significant issue can occur if unit operations built to get rid of chlorine ended up, devoid of warning, challenged with chloramine-that contains ingesting water from the municipality that had been mandated to cease use of chlorine disinfection to comply with ever tightening EPA Drinking Water THM specifications.

Reverse Osmosis Reverse osmosis (RO) units employ semipermeable membranes. The “pores” of RO membranes are actually intersegmental Areas Amongst the polymer molecules. They are really big enough for permeation of water molecules, but also little to allow passage of hydrated chemical ions. Even so, many variables which includes pH, temperature, and differential force across the membrane impact the selectivity of the permeation.

Water for Hemodialysis— Water for Hemodialysis (see USP monograph) is utilized for hemodialysis programs, principally the dilution of hemodialysis focus solutions. It really is generated and made use of on-website and it is constructed from EPA Ingesting Water that has been more purified to cut back chemical and microbiological factors. It might be packaged and saved in unreactive containers that preclude bacterial entry. The time period “unreactive containers” indicates which the container, Primarily its water Get in touch with surfaces, are certainly not adjusted in any way with the water, for instance by leaching of container-linked compounds into the water or by any chemical reaction or corrosion attributable to the water. The water has no additional antimicrobials and isn't intended for injection. Its attributes include specifications for Water conductivity, Total natural and organic carbon (or oxidizable substances), Microbial limits, and Bacterial endotoxins. The water conductivity and total natural and organic carbon characteristics are identical to People founded for Purified Water and Water for Injection; nonetheless, as an alternative to complete organic carbon, the organic and natural articles could alternatively be calculated with the test for Oxidizable substances. The Microbial limits attribute for this water is unique Amongst the “bulk” water monographs, but is justified on the basis of the water's certain software that has microbial content necessities linked to its safe use. The Bacterial endotoxins attribute is Also established at a amount linked to its safe use.
